The only place I have found tap-box snuff consistently “perfect” at time of purchase is John Hollingsworth’s in Birmingham, where it is stored in a humidor.

It’s usually good when received by post from Tim & Julia at Snuff Store [I guess they, too, have good storage facilities - I also know their stock is generally very fresh].

However, I have needed to place SG tap-boxes [and, it must be said, those from GH as well] my “super-moist” humidor after only a few days.  Contrast this with the superb seals on either Fribourg & Treyer tubes, or the 10g tins in which Snuff Store sell their own “house” sorts.  The irony here is that I understand many of the Snuff Store “house” sorts are blended at Kendal Brown House - begs the question as to why SG cannot supply their own product in Snuff Store type tins.

Part of my guess is that SG invested a lot of money in the “Bernard style” tap-box machinery, and are loathe to admit that it may have been a mistake.

That said, the concept of the SG tap box, for convenience when out for the evening, or during the working day, is excellent - if only it could also keep good snuff fresh.
